Cristina Abad‐Molina is a scholar working on Immunology, Hepatology and Epidemi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Cristina Abad‐Molina has authored 15 papers receiving a total of 295 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 7 papers in Immunology, 5 papers in Hepatology and 4 papers in Epidemiology. Recurrent topics in Cristina Abad‐Molina’s work include Hepatitis C virus research (5 papers), Immune Cell Function and Interaction (5 papers) and T-cell and B-cell Immunology (2 papers). Cristina Abad‐Molina is often cited by papers focused on Hepatitis C virus research (5 papers), Immune Cell Function and Interaction (5 papers) and T-cell and B-cell Immunology (2 papers). Cristina Abad‐Molina collaborates with scholars based in Spain, United States and United Kingdom. Cristina Abad‐Molina's co-authors include Antonio Núñez‐Roldán, María Francisca González‐Escribano, Manuel Romero‐Gómez, J. Aguilar‐Reina, José R. García‐Lozano, Natalia Barroso, Marco Antonio Montes‐Cano, Miguel Genebat, Marı́a-Francisca González-Escribano and Kawthar Machmach and has published in prestigious journals such as Hepatology, The Journal of Infectious Diseases and Journal of Hepatology.
